Calculating Your Thần Số Học (Vietnamese Numerology) Life Path for 2026

To decode the specific energetic resonance of 2026, one must first establish the foundational Life Path Number, which acts as the static denominator in our numerological equation. In the context of Thần Số Học, the calculation remains rooted in the Pythagorean tradition, yet it is often interpreted through the lens of cyclical progression. Your Life Path Number is derived from the sum of the digits in your date of birth, reduced to a single digit (1–9) or a Master Number (11, 22, or 33).

The transition into 2026 requires a precise calculation of your Personal Year Number. The formula is as follows: (Day of Birth + Month of Birth + Universal Year 2026). For the year 2026, the Universal Year number is calculated as 2+0+2+6 = 10; 1+0 = 1. Therefore, 2026 acts as a "Year 1" in the global cycle, signaling a period of initiation and new beginnings. By adding your specific birth data to this frequency, you reveal the unique vibration you will experience throughout the calendar year.

Consider an individual born on October 14th. The calculation for their 2026 Personal Year would proceed as follows:

  • Birth Day: 1 + 4 = 5
  • Birth Month: 1 + 0 = 1
  • Universal Year 2026: 1
  • Total: 5 + 1 + 1 = 7

In this instance, the individual enters a Personal Year 7, a period defined by introspection, analytical rigor, and spiritual refinement. ❓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
❓ How do I calculate my personal year number 2026?
To calculate your personal year number 2026, add your birth day, your birth month, and the universal year number for 2026 (which is 2+0+2+6 = 10, and 1+0 = 1). Keep reducing the final sum to a single digit between 1 and 9. For example, if you were born on July 15, you add 7 + (1+5) + 1 = 14, then 1+4 = 5. Your personal year number would be 5.
❓ What does a personal year number 1 mean in 2026?
A personal year number 1 in 2026 signifies a powerful time of new beginnings, fresh starts, and independent action. According to Thần Số Học (Vietnamese Numerology), this is the start of a new nine-year cycle. You are encouraged to plant seeds for the future, take bold leadership roles, and embrace innovative ideas that will shape the next decade of your life.
